/* support function to save scene as PPM image */
static void
_scene_save(Evas *canvas,
const char *dest)
{
const unsigned int *pixels, *pixels_end;
int width, height;
FILE *f;
evas_output_size_get(canvas, &width, &height);
f = fopen(dest, "wb+");
if (!f)
{
fprintf(stderr, "ERROR: could not open for writing '%s': %s\n",
dest, strerror(errno));
return;
}
pixels_end = pixels + (width * height);
/* PPM P6 format is dead simple to write: */
fprintf(f, "P6\n%d %d\n255\n", width, height);
for (; pixels < pixels_end; pixels++)
{
int r, g, b;
r = ((*pixels) & 0xff0000) >> 16;
g = ((*pixels) & 0x00ff00) >> 8;
b = (*pixels) & 0x0000ff;
fprintf(f, "%c%c%c", r, g, b);
}
fclose(f);
printf("Saved scene as '%s'\n", dest);
}
